Grose Vale suburb profile

Grose Vale is a picturesque rural suburb located in the Hawkesbury region of New South Wales, offering a serene lifestyle amidst natural beauty. Known for its expansive landscapes, it provides residents with a tranquil escape from the hustle and bustle of city life. The suburb is characterized by its lush greenery, rolling hills, and a strong sense of community, making it ideal for families and nature enthusiasts. Grose Vale is conveniently situated near the Blue Mountains, providing easy access to outdoor recreational activities. Its peaceful environment and scenic vistas make it a desirable location for those seeking a rural retreat.

Grose Vale demographics

Grose Vale, nestled in the picturesque Hawkesbury region of New South Wales, offers a serene and family-friendly environment. With a population of 1,272, this suburb is characterized by its spacious properties and rural charm, making it an ideal location for those seeking a peaceful lifestyle away from the hustle and bustle of city life. The median age of 46 suggests a mature community, with many residents enjoying the tranquility and natural beauty that Grose Vale provides.

The suburb is predominantly composed of couple families, with 50.1% having children and 39.0% without, indicating a strong family-oriented community. The presence of one-parent families at 10.0% adds to the diversity of family structures within the area. Grose Vale's high median household income of $2,447 per week reflects the affluence and stability of its residents, many of whom are likely to be established professionals or retirees enjoying the fruits of their labor.

Property ownership in Grose Vale is notably high, with 48.3% of homes owned outright and 44.5% owned with a mortgage. This high level of homeownership underscores the suburb's appeal to those seeking long-term residence and investment in a stable community. Only 7.2% of properties are rented, highlighting the area's focus on homeownership and the commitment of its residents to maintaining a close-knit and stable environment.
